  • Many of small-scale devices should be designed to tolerate high temperature changes. In the present study, the states of buckling and stability of nano-scale cylindrical shell structure integrated with piezoelectric layer under various thermal and electrical external loadings are scrutinized. In this regard, a multi-layer composite shell reinforced with graphene nano-platelets (GNP) having different patterns of layer configurations is modeled. An outer layer of piezoelectric material receiving external voltage is also attached to the cylindrical shell for the aim of observing the effects of voltage on the thermal buckling condition. The cylindrical shell is mathematically modeled with first-order shear deformation theory (FSDT). Linear elasticity relationship with constant thermal expansion coefficient is used to extract the relationship between stress and strain components. Moreover, minimum virtual work, including the work of the piezoelectric layer, is engaged to derive equations of motion. The derived equations are solved using numerical method to find out the effects of temperature and external voltage on the buckling stability of the shell structure. It is revealed that the boundary condition, external voltage and geometrical parameter of the shell structure have notable effects on the temperature rise required for initiating instability in the cylindrical shell structure.

  • The present study aims to analyze the magneto-electro-elastic (MEE) vibration of a functionally graded carbon nanotubes reinforced composites (FG-CNTRC) cylindrical shell. Electro-magnetic loads are applied to the structure and it is located on an elastic foundation which is simulated by visco-Pasternak type. The properties of the nano-composite shell are assumed to be varied by temperature changes. The third-order shear deformation shells theory is used to describe the displacement components and Hamilton's principle is employed to derive the motion differential equations. To obtain the results, Navier's method is used as an analytical solution for simply supported boundary condition and the effect of different parameters such as temperature variations, orientation angle, volume fraction of CNTs, different types of elastic foundation and other prominent parameters on the natural frequencies of the structure are considered and discussed in details. Design more functional structures subjected to multi-physical fields is of applications of this study results.

  • Natural frequency behavior of graphene platelets reinforced composite (GPL-RC) joined truncated conical-cylindrical- conical shells resting on Winkler-type elastic foundation is presented in this paper for the first time. The rule of mixture and the modified Halpin-Tsai approach are applied to achieve the mechanical properties of the structure. Four different graphene platelets patterns are considered along the thickness of the structure such as GPLA, GPLO, GPLX, GPLUD. Finite element procedure according to Rayleigh-Ritz formulation has been used to solve 2D-axisymmetric elasticity equations. Application of 2D axisymmetric elasticity theory allows thickness stretching unlike simple shell theories, and this gives more accurate results, especially for thick shells. An efficient parametric investigation is also presented to show the effects of various geometric variables, three different boundary conditions, stiffness of elastic foundation, dispersion pattern and weight fraction of GPLs nanofillers on the natural frequencies of the joined shell. Results show that GPLO and BC3 provide the most rigidity that cause the most natural frequencies among different BCs and GPL patterns. Also, by increasing the weigh fraction of nanofillers, the natural frequencies will increase up to 200%.

  • Based on the structure feature of a tree, a cylindrical $Ti_2AlC$/graphite layered composite has been fabricated through heat treating a graphite column and six close-matched thin wall $Ti_2AlC$ cylinders bonded with the $Ti_2AlC$ powders at $1300^{\circ}C$ and low oxygen partial pressure. SEM examination reveals that the bond interlayers between cylinders or that between cylinder and column are not fully dense without any crack formation. During the compressive test, the strain of the $Ti_2AlC$/graphite layered composite is about twice higher than that of the monolithic $Ti_2AlC$ ceramic, and the compressive strength of the layered composite is 348 MPa. The layered composite show the noncatastrophic fracture behaviors due to the debonding and shelling off of the layers, which are different from the monolithic $Ti_2AlC$ ceramic. The mechanism of the improved deformation capacity and noncatastrophic failure modes are attributed to the presence of the central soft graphite column and cracks deflection by the bond interlayers.

  • 본 연구에서는 등분포 하중을 받는 섬유 보강 복합재료 관의 좌굴 거동을 분석하였다. 등방성의 원통형 구조물의 경우, 좌굴 형상은 단면만 변형할 뿐 길이방향으로의 단면 형상은 일정한 2차원 좌굴이 발생하나, 섬유 보강 복합재료와 같은 이방성 재료로 구성된 원통형 구조물의 경우에는 길이 방향으로 단면의 형상이 변화하는 3차원 좌굴이 발생하게 된다, 또한 적층 구조물에서는 적층각의 변화에 따라 각 방향에 따른 재료의 강도가 변화하므로, 적층각의 변화는 구조물의 강도를 변화시킨다. 본 연구에서는 원통형 적층 구조물의 2차원 좌굴과 3차원 좌굴의 경계를 조사하고, 적층각 변화에 따른 섬유 보강 복합재료 관의 좌굴 강도를 평가하였다.

  • 마이크로스트림 안테나는 가볍고 부피가 작을 뿐만 아니라 집적화가 가능하고, 표면 부착력이 탁월하여 많은 통신 시스템 안테나로 응용되고 있다. 안테나의 구조는 12.5GHz의 중심주파수를 갖는 사각 패치 마이크로 스트립 안테나로 설계하였고 곡률 방향으로 패치를 확장시켜 총 4개의 패치를 배열시켰다. 양쪽의 복합재료 사이에 허니컴을 삽입한 샌드위치 구조물이 되도록 설계한 다음 충격 실험을 실시하였다. 충격실험 후 안테나 성능변화를 측정한 결과 영향을 받지 않는다는 것을 확인하였다.

  • A cable-stiffened cylindrical single-layer latticed shell that is reinforced by cable-stiffened system has superior stability behaviour compared with the ordinary cylindrical latticed shell. The layouts of cable-stiffened system are flexible in this structural system, and different layouts contribute different stiffness to the structure. However, the existed few research primarily focused on the simplest type of cable layouts, in which the grids of the latticed shell are diagonally stiffened by prestressed cables in-plane. This current work examines the stability behaviour of the cable-stiffened cylindrical latticed shells with two different types of cable layouts using nonlinear finite element analysis. A parametric study on the effect of cross-sectional of the cables, pretension in cables, joint stiffness, initial imperfections, load distributions and boundary conditions is presented. The findings are useful for the reference of the designer in using this type of structural system.

  • This paper deals with the mechanical behaviour of the thin-walled cylindrical air-spring shell (CAS) made of rubber-textile cord composite (RCC) subjected to different types of loading. An orthotropic hyperelastic constitutive model is presented which can be applied to numerical simulation for the response of biological soft tissue and of the nonlinear anisotropic hyperelastic material of the CAS used in vibroisolation of driver's seat. The parameters of strain energy function of the constitutive model are fitted to the experimental results by the nonlinear least squares method. The deformation of the inflated CAS is calculated by solving the system of five first-order ordinary differential equations with the material constitutive law and proper boundary conditions. Nonlinear hyperelastic constitutive equations of orthotropic composite material are incorporated into the finite strain analysis by finite element method (FEM). The results for the deformation analysis of the inflated CAS made of RCC are given. Numerical results of principal stretches and deformed profiles of the inflated CAS obtained by numerical deformation analysis are compared with experimental ones.

  • The optimal design for stiffened laminated composite cylindrical panels under axial compression was studied using linear and nonlinear deformation theories by finite difference energy methods. Various panel structures was made from Carbon/Epoxy USN125 prepreg and considered 3 types stiffeners. Optimal design analyses of panel structure are carried out by the nonlinear search optimizer, ADS. This optimal design results are compared to the FEM result using ANSYS.

  • Classical and first-order nonlocal beam theory are employed in this study to assess the thermal buckling performance of a small-scale conical, cylindrical beam. The beam is constructed from functionally graded (FG) porosity-dependent material and operates under the thermal conditions of the environment. Imperfections within the non-uniform beam vary along both the radius and length direction, with continuous changes in thickness throughout its length. The resulting structure is functionally graded in both radial and axial directions, forming a bi-directional configuration. Utilizing the energy method, governing equations are derived to analyze the thermal stability and buckling characteristics of a nanobeam across different beam theories. Subsequently, the extracted partial differential equations (PDE) are numerically solved using the generalized differential quadratic method (GDQM), providing a comprehensive exploration of the thermal behavior of the system. The detailed discussion of the produced results is based on various applied effective parameters, with a focus on the potential application of nanotubes in enhancing sports bikes performance.
